How Unlock the Mystery: How Hexadecimal to Decimal Conversion Actually Works

Hexadecimal uses base-16, with digits 0–9 and letters A–F, representing values 0 to 15. Each digit holds a positional weight, just like decimal, but balanced on 16 instead of 10. To convert, multiply each hex digit by 16 raised to the power of its position—starting from right (position 0). For example, the hex value 1A becomes:
(1 × 16¹) + (10 × 16⁰) = 16 + 10 = 26 in decimal.
This simple math ensures computers represent data efficiently and operators interpret code accurately. Recognizing this process illuminates how systems preserve integrity across programming, networking, and hardware design.

Q: Why do we use hexadecimal if decimal is more familiar?
Hex works with just 16 symbols instead of 10, making it a compact, intuitive way to represent large binary numbers. It aligns cleanly with 8-bit byte groups, simplifying readability in memory addressing and low-level coding.
